What is a Sizzle Pan?
A sizzle pan, often referred to as a sizzling platter, is a flat, shallow cooking pan that is particularly well-suited for preparing a variety of dishes. Its design allows for even heat distribution, which is crucial for achieving that perfect sear on meats, searing vegetables to lock in their flavors, or even for serving hot dishes right at the table. The sizzle pan is often pre-heated, allowing for a quick and intense cook, which can help in creating a delightful crust while keeping the inside moist and tender.

Benefits of Using a Sizzle Pan
1. Even Cooking The materials used for sizzle pans, especially if they are made of cast iron, provide excellent heat retention and distribution, ensuring that food cooks evenly.
2. Flavor Enhancement Searing meats on a hot sizzle pan can develop a rich, caramelized crust, enhancing the overall taste of the dish. This technique locks in natural juices, leading to a more flavorful meal.
3. Table Presentation Serving directly from a sizzle pan allows for a captivating presentation. The dramatic searing sound and the sight of food bubble and hiss create excitement among diners, making meals more engaging.
4. Easy Maintenance Many modern sizzle pans are designed with a non-stick surface, making them easy to clean. Whether you are cooking with oil or other fats, the clean-up process is often smoother than with traditional cookware.
Tips for Using a Sizzle Pan
To maximize the use of a sizzle pan, consider the following tips
- Preheat the Pan To achieve the best results, ensure the pan is adequately preheated before adding food. This step is critical for obtaining that desirable sizzle and flavor. - Use High Smoke Point Oils Select oils that can withstand high temperatures, such as avocado or grapeseed oil, to avoid burning and affecting the taste of your dishes.
- Pat Dry Your Ingredients Moisture can hinder the searing process. Patting down meats and vegetables with a paper towel ensures they achieve that perfect brown crust.
- Avoid Overcrowding To maintain high heat and steam, avoid overcrowding the pan. Cook in batches if necessary to ensure even cooking.
